SUMMARY OF FUNCTIONS :
The Master Production Scheduler reports to the Director of Operations and is responsible for the management and administrative tasks required to shepherd production orders efficiently and accurately through the ERP processes. A solid understanding of production concepts and procedures applicable to the manufacturing industry is required. Primary responsibility is to manage production orders from activation through completion, ensuring accurate component and semi-finished good backflushing and finished good output.
MAJOR D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ES :
- Understands and reviews production capabilities and capacity.
- Monitors the initiation of production orders in the production dashboard system
- Follows production closely to monitor actual output versus system output
- Ensures accurate component and semi-finished materials backflush
- Monitors for and efficiently clears errors blocking any of the above activities
- Monitors closely the introduction of new models to ensure error-free system execution and confirm proper BOM setup
- Works closely with master scheduler to ensure available production orders for all upcoming production needs
- Adjusts, as necessary, standard and updated work orders to match production needs
- Assigns previously finished goods to applicable work orders, where needed
- Monitors output of quality-flagged units and reintroduction into the production environment after usage decision
- Learns the basics of the master scheduler function to serve as a backup to these responsibilities
- Documents Master Production Scheduler processes and trains other users as necessary
- Streamlining of the coordination process with continuous improvements and recommendations
